WebJan 7, 2016 · Franked Mail is identified by the member’s facsimile signature — the frank — in the upper right corner of the envelope or label in place of a postage stamp. The frank includes “M.C.” (member of Congress) or “U.S.S.” (U.S. Senate). An article in this week’s edition of Postal Bulletin shows examples of Franked Mail and emphasizes ... WebDec 19, 2016 · Congress then reimburses the U.S. Postal Service through the legislative branch for all of their franked mail. ... The history of the frank in the new nation began when the first Congress of the United States enacted a franking law in 1789, and franking has remained a valuable governmental tool for more than 200 years. WebThe American Red Cross provided free frank cards so that soldiers could assure their families that they had crossed the Atlantic safely. CENSORED MILITARY MAIL, 1918. Prior to WW II, mail was franked as either officer's mail or soldier's mail. This cover has an Army Postal Service cancel and a censor mark. WebDec 9, 2004 · 1.1 Members of Congress. Official mail of Members of Congress is sent without prepayment of postage and bears instead either a written or printed facsimile signature or a specified marking.
